The cheapest way to get from Wading River to Brooklyn is to drive which costs $12 - $18 and takes 1h 33m.
The fastest way to get from Wading River to Brooklyn is to drive which takes 1h 33m and costs $12 - $18.
No, there is no direct bus from Wading River to Brooklyn. However, there are services departing from Wading River Manor Rd/Benjamin St and arriving at Park Slope-Prospect Park West & Union via Old Country Rd/Tanger Mall Dr.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 52m.
The distance between Wading River and Brooklyn is 66 miles. The road distance is 66.6 miles.
The best way to get from Wading River to Brooklyn without a car is to line 62 bus and train which takes 2h 53m and costs $16 - $35.
It takes approximately 2h 53m to get from Wading River to Brooklyn, including transfers.
Wading River to Brooklyn bus services, operated by Hampton Jitney Inc., depart from Old Country Rd/Tanger Mall Dr station.
Wading River to Brooklyn bus services, operated by Hampton Jitney Inc., arrive at Park Slope-Prospect Park West & Union station.
Yes, the driving distance between Wading River to Brooklyn is 67 miles. It takes approximately 1h 33m to drive from Wading River to Brooklyn.
